Disc Coil Spring using Curve from Equation in Pro/ENGINEER

TUTORIAL: Disc Coil Spring using Curve from Equation in Pro/ENGINEER

Version: Pro/E 2001, Wildfire, Wildfire2.0, Wildfire3.0, wildfire4.0

Datum Curve from Equation tool is to be used when you want to create a disc coil spring / planar spring in Pro/ENGINEER. We are going to create a datum curve from equation as the trajectory and then apply a sweep thru the spiral curve.

1. Create a new Solid Part file. From the tools icon, click the create datum curve icon1.create_datumcurve .

2. In the pops-up menu manager, choose From Equation and Done to proceed.

3. The Curve: From Equation dialog box appears and you are requested to select a coordinate system (CSYS). Select a Csys from the display.

4. You will need to define the Csys Type. For this tutorial, choose Cylindrical in the menu manager and proceed to the next step.

5. Next, a Notepad window appears for you to input the Equation. You can write any mathematical equation to model the desire curve. For a spiral curve sit on a planar, the following equation is being use

R = 50 + t * (120)
Theta = t * 360 * 5
Z = 0

6. You can substitute the values accordingly to design your own disc coil spring. The figure below may help you to understand the equation better.

7. When you are done, click OK on the Curve: From Equation dialog box to confirm. The spiral curve should appear in your display by now.

After all, you can use the sweep feature to complete the disc coil spring.
